1. Middle East Decorative Mesh: Why the Market Is Poised to Grow
1.1 Infrastructure Boom & Vision Projects
Countries like Saudi Arabia, the UAE, and Qatar are investing heavily in visionary mega‑projects (e.g., NEOM, The Line, Expo-related infrastructure).
These projects place a high premium on design innovation, sustainability, and long-lasting materials — making decorative mesh an attractive choice for facades, canopies, sun‑screens, and artistic elements.

1.2 Sustainable & Green Building Trends
As Middle Eastern nations aim for carbon neutrality and green building certifications, there’s growing demand for building materials that offer both function and aesthetics.
Decorative mesh can serve as solar shading / sunscreen systems, helping reduce building cooling loads.
Metal mesh is also highly recyclable, aligning with circular economy goals.
1.3 Design Diversification & Customization
Architects and designers are increasingly choosing complex geometries and culturally inspired motifs, including Islamic geometric patterns, arabesque designs, and parametric forms.
With 3D modeling and CNC / laser cutting technology improving, custom decorative mesh panels are becoming more accessible and cost-effective.
1.4 Technological Integration
Mesh is not just decorative — it’s becoming smart façades, integrating lighting (LED), projection, and even sensor systems.
The rise of smart cities in the Gulf further supports mesh as a material for interactive, dynamic building facades.
1.5 Durability & Performance Demand
The Middle East’s harsh climate — extreme heat, UV exposure, sandstorms, and salt-laden coastal air — requires mesh products with superior corrosion resistance, stable color, and structural strength.
Clients will favor materials like stainless steel, aluminum, or galvanized + coated steel.

3. Recommended Decorative Mesh Products for Middle East Market
Based on these forecasted trends, here are several mesh products that Chinese manufacturers should prioritize for the Middle East:
1. Expanded Metal Mesh Panels
Material: Stainless steel, aluminum, or coated steel
Use cases: Façades, sunscreen panels, elevated walkways, privacy screens
Benefits: Custom geometry, high strength, airflow control, shading properties
2. Laser‑Cut & Perforated Metal Mesh
Material: Powder-coated steel, stainless steel
Use cases: Architectural facades, interior partitions, decorative balconies
Benefits: Precise patterns (Islamic geometry, modern motifs), modular design
3. 3D Woven or Crimped Mesh
Material: Stainless steel, brass, or coated steel
Use cases: Building facades, atriums, ceiling features
Benefits: Visual depth, architectural texture, light diffusion
4. Aluminum Mesh for Sun-Shading Systems
Material: Anodized or powder-coated aluminum
Use cases: Brise-soleil, louver systems, solar shading facades
Benefits: Lightweight, anti-corrosion, easy to mount, long lifespan
5. Modular Prefab Mesh Panels
Material: Coated steel or aluminum
Use cases: High-rise buildings, commercial complexes, hotels
Benefits: On-site quick installation, reduced labor cost, tested modules
6. Decorative Mesh with Smart Integration
Material: Stainless + integrated electronics or LED mounts
Use cases: Interactive façades, illuminated walls, art installations
Benefits: Future-proof for smart city projects, aesthetic + functional
4. How Chinese Manufacturers Can Capitalize
To capture the next wave of growth in the Middle East decorative mesh market, Chinese suppliers should:
Invest in Design & R&D
Build a strong design team capable of working with architects to deliver cultural motifs and parametric patterns.
Use software like Rhino or Grasshopper, and support laser cutting / CNC.
Upgrade Manufacturing & Testing
Ensure salt spray test, UV aging test, structural wind load testing for mesh.
Obtain quality certifications (ISO, SGS) to meet high-end client expectations.
Develop Modular Systems
Produce mesh in modular, pre‑assembled panels.
Provide mounting systems or turnkey kits so that installation is fast and consistent.
Offer Smart-Mesh Solutions
Partner with lighting or IoT companies to offer mesh panels that integrate LED, sensors, or projection.
Ensure your mesh supports embedded devices securely and safely.
Promote Sustainability
Use recycled materials or recyclable metals.
Document environmental practices, and provide eco-certificates if available.
Localize Sales & Support
Establish partnerships or local stock in Middle Eastern countries.
Participate in architectural, construction & design trade shows in the Gulf region (e.g., Big 5 Dubai).
Provide local-language catalogs and technical support (Arabic, English).
